Title: Edward T. Carter: Innovator in Microporous Membrane Technology
Introduction
Edward T. Carter is a notable inventor based in Worcester, MA (US). He has made significant contributions to the field of polymer technology, particularly in the development of microporous membranes. With a total of 2 patents, his work has advanced the understanding and application of nylon materials in various industries.
Latest Patents
Carter's latest patents include innovations in aromatic/aliphatic nylon polymer microporous membranes. These membranes are prepared from a polyamide (nylon) polymer that contains aromatic rings, aliphatic carbon chains, and amide groups. They exhibit improved long-term performance characteristics, making them suitable for various applications. Another significant patent focuses on the production of heat-resistant microporous materials. This invention allows for the retention of near-constant time to hydrosaturation during and after heating, which is essential for sealing multiple surfaces together.
